Harnessing Solar Energy for Illumination
Solar spot lights are a type of outdoor lighting that rely on photovoltaic panels to convert sunlight into electricity. This energy is stored in rechargeable batteries during the day and then utilized to power LED (Light Emitting Diode) lights during the night. The use of LEDs ensures not only bright and focused lighting but also high energy efficiency and longevity.
Advantages of Solar Spot Lights
Energy Efficiency and Cost Savings: One of the primary advantages of solar spot lights is their minimal impact on your electricity bill. Since they draw their energy directly from the sun, they don't require electricity from the grid. This translates into significant cost savings over time, making them a financially prudent choice.
Environmentally Friendly: Solar spot lights contribute to reducing carbon emissions and the overall carbon footprint. By utilizing renewable solar energy, these lights help to conserve non-renewable resources and decrease dependence on fossil fuels, thus playing a role in combating climate change.
Easy Installation: Solar spot lights are relatively easy to install compared to traditional wired lighting systems. They don't require extensive wiring or trenching, making them a practical option for both homeowners and businesses. This also means less disruption to your outdoor space during installation.
Low Maintenance: Solar spot lights have few moving parts and are designed for durability. Once installed, they generally require minimal maintenance. Regular cleaning of the solar panels to ensure optimal energy absorption and occasional battery replacements are usually the extent of maintenance required.
Versatility in Design and Functionality: Solar spot lights come in various designs and styles, allowing you to choose options that complement your outdoor aesthetics. Additionally, they offer adjustable features that enable you to direct the light precisely where you need it – whether it's illuminating a garden path, highlighting a statue, or enhancing your home's architectural features.
Remote Locations and Power Outages: Solar spot lights are especially advantageous in remote areas or during power outages. They can provide consistent lighting without relying on an external power source, enhancing safety and security in such situations.
Considerations and Conclusion
While solar spot lights offer numerous advantages, it's essential to consider a few factors before making a purchase. The efficiency of the lights depends on the amount of sunlight they receive, so it's important to install them in areas with sufficient sun exposure. Additionally, the initial investment might be higher compared to traditional lights, but the long-term savings and environmental benefits often outweigh this.
